Abstract
Mobile network operators are faced with tremendous data growth in their networks. Complex and multilayered networks, high-quality signal demands, and strong competition are only some of the aspects that push operators to further optimize their networks. Also, introduction of 5G in their networks enabled mobile operators to offer broad spectrum of 5G services, especially IoT (Internet of Things) and M2M (Machine to Machine) services which further increase traffic volume and the amount of collected data. Traditional data management solutions currently used are not able to successfully respond to such huge amounts of data. Big data technologies represent a modern approach for coping with the enormous data quantities. In this paper, we propose a big data solution that can collect and process huge amounts of data to extract valuable information and help mobile operators to bring their networks to enhanced quality level and offer full IoT solutions to their customers.
